Safe scooter operation means matching your speed, route, and riding habits to the space, surface, weather, and people around you. This category helps you think through everyday decisions before you ride. You can compare safer speeds for stores, sidewalks, and crowds. You can learn what to check before each trip, including tires, battery, brakes, lights, and loose parts. You can also review basic riding skills like turning, stopping, and parking with more confidence.

Use these guides when you are unsure about a place or condition. Sidewalk and road articles explain US rules, right-of-way, and safety tips. Ramp and surface articles cover grass, gravel, uneven ground, slopes, curbs, turns, and weight balance. Weather articles look at rain, heat, cold, and low visibility, so you can decide when extra caution is needed or when a ride may not be a good idea.

These articles are for riders, caregivers, and family members who want a clearer safety routine. They do not replace training from a qualified professional. If you have questions about your balance, vision, reaction time, or whether a scooter is safe for your needs, ask a physician or therapist.
